    You nearly always need at least one date and one place. Keep researching until you get sufficient information to add what you need to her record and then you will be able to request it. Have you found the family in any census records? That would generally provide what you need. If they lived in the US, you should be able to find her in the 1900, 1910, 1920, 1930, and 1940 census records, depending on when she was born and how long she lived.
